Mangini, Marinelli, Crennel Out
Less than 24 hours after the NFL season ended, three head coaches were asked to clear out their offices.

New York Jets head coach Eric Mangini is out as of today. The decisionwas no doubt decided upon after a devastating loss at home to the MiamiDolphins 17-24. Yesterday's game was the deciding game for the AFC Eastcrown and ended up being the deciding game in Mangini's run in New York.

Heisman Goes To Bradford
In what was one of the most tightly contested Heisman races ever, the2008 Heisman trophy went to Oklahoma quarterback Sam Bradford.

In the first time in the history of the Heisman all of the finalists were underclassmen:

Tim Tebow: Junior
Colt McCoy: Junior
Sam Bradford: Sophomore
